Output 40e8af05052344043da2630bea45c7efcfaf0e0ca88b13a9de4fc3c29b3c2b9b:0

value
9522840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99f5bcd47841f3e8827b98d78e766a2171f5bfb OP_EQUAL
address
3L56eXmppwz8mz218WVRsDAtgJEHQgZabd
transaction
40e8af05052344043da2630bea45c7efcfaf0e0ca88b13a9de4fc3c29b3c2b9b